Lamborghini Veneno

The Lamborghini Veneno is already a rare masterpiece in itself, and today, the Italian supercar maker has confirmed that there will be a roadster variant of this exquisite car.

The Veneno is based on her more famous sibling, the Aventador, and now a topless Veneno will soon wow the world.

However, if you were hoping to get your hands on one of these, your just out of luck. Only four will built and one of these will go to the Lamborghini Museum in Sant’ Agata, Italy.

The other three Veneno Roadsters (as it is officially being called) were sold for a whopping $4 million each!

Gallery: The current, hard top Veveno –

There has long since been rumours that Lamborghini was considering manufacturing a roadster version of the Veneno. Many supercar-lovers’ dreams came true when the rumours were confirmed by Car and Driver during an interview with the CEO of Lamborghini, Stephan Winkelmann.

At $4 million, the Veneno Roadster is 10% more expensive than the Veneno hard top.

With exception of the hard roof, making way for a roadster roof, the Veneno roadster will unlikely showcase any other major styling changes – however, we will have to wait to see what happens.
